The instant is the writ petition which has been filed assailing the order of termination from the service dated 10.04.2025' The petitioner herein was appointed for the post of office Subordinate in the Court of V Additional District and Sessions Judge, Miryalaguda. He was appointed pursuant to Notification No.6/2023, dated 02.01.2023 and was appointed vide proceedings dated 03.01.2024 on the post of office Subordinate' The notification specificalty envisages that maximum qualihcation that is required for the post of offrce Subordinale was S.S.C' with further condition that whoever is more qualihed than that is required shall not be eligible for applying the said post. 2

3. The petitioner applied for the said post declaring his qualification as S.S.C. and also given an undertakirg which reads as under: " I am not possessing any higher qualification than SSC and if any information fumished by me is fc,und false or inconect my appointment to the post ol Office Subordinate shall be terminated and I am also lirrble for criminal prosecution." 1?- 4 Subsequent to his order of appointment bein6i ;issued, it was leamt that the petitioner had suppressed his qualification and has obtained employment by playing mischief and fiaud on the employer. The petitioner had already acquired Inr.e6"6iu,. urd had also a degree in B.Sc. When this fact came t,t the notice of the respondents, the impugned order has been passec

Today, when the matter is taken-up, during the course of hearing on adlnission, a query put to leamed counsel for the petitioner, he did not dispute the fact that the petitioner is a graduate with I].Sc. degree. He also did not dispure the fact that while obtaining employment, the petitioner infact l-rad given an undertaking that he does not have higher qualificati,rn than S.S.C. that which was required for the post of offrce Subordinate. These two admitted facts are itself sufficient to reach to a conclusion that \ 3 the petitioner had obtained employment by material suppression and by playing fraud on the employer. The contention of leamed counsel for the petitioner before issuance of order of termination the respondents ought to have conducted an enquiry may not be necessary for two reasons. First for the reason that in the affrdavit 'filed by the petitioner himself has admitted that he had higher qualification and second is in the order of appointment, iself, clearly reflects that in the event on verification of antecedents, the selection of candidate was found to have been erroneously made I \ they shall be removed. Likewise, there was also a condition that nature of employment being purely temporary, the services are \ I liable to be terminated without assigning any reasons and notice.

6. In the teeth of the aforesaid conditions indicated in the appointment order, the petitioner having obtained employment by material suppression of facts, we are of the considered opinion that issuance of show-cause notice or holding of enquiry would become only an empty formality. In terms of order of appointment itself the services had been terminated, which the respondents have undertaken and therefore, we do not find any illegality with the order so passed. ,/ 4

7. The Writ Petition fails and is accordingly dismissed. No costs. Consequently, miscellaneous petitions pendinp,, if any, shall stand closed. To, //TRUE COPY// SD/.
